Given numbers are 950, 284, 943, 233
The list of prime factors of all numbers are
Prime factors of 950 are 2 x 5 x 5 x 19
Prime factors of 284 are 2 x 2 x 71
Prime factors of 943 are 23 x 41
Prime factors of 233 are 233
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
